Bulk Emailing
We've created a powerful new function to enable you to email some of your regular documents (sales invoices, customer statements and supplier remittances) out to your suppliers and customers in batches. The Bulk Emailing function is located under the ''General'' menu.
You simply pick the type of report that you want to email out, the system will pick up your email address from your user profile in the admin layer, and you can then enter a subject and message to accompany the email.
Next you need to specify the selection criteria for the bulk email. This is the same as running a report, for example you could select a range of invoices by internal reference.

You can then generate the emails. The system will tell you if there are any email addresses missing from your supplier and customer accounts. You can add these to an outgoing message by clicking ''edit'' and updating the message. Alternatively, you can update your supplier/customer master records with the relevant addresses and they will be picked up here any time you create a bulk email.
Next select the emails you wish to send and then click ''Email''. The system will tell you when they have sent.

General Ledger Explorer
We have significantly redesigned the Budget Screen and created some new reporting and analysis features. We now call this function The General Ledger Explorer.
It enables you to view actual GL Account values, enter budgets and revised budgets as well as analyse and compare figures between periods and financial years.
It's accessible from the General Ledger Listing Screen by clicking on the icon beside each account or by taking the option from the ''General'' drop down menu.

The GL Explorer has the following features:
- Download an Excel-based budget template and upload the completed file into AccountsIQ
- Create columnar comparisons between actual and budget or revised budgets. You can also view year on year comparisons e.g 2008 actuals vs 2007 etc. Depending on the options selected, the variances will display as positive or negative values
- Analyse groups of accounts by Category, Sub Category and Department. For example, you could choose to select all Revenue and Expenditure categories of accounts and the system will summarise the values into an overall figure that can be compared to budget
- Drilldown from a period value to the underlying transactions in the Audi Trail
- You can use the functions at the bottom of the page to adjust budgets by a certain percentage, copy last year's actuals into this year's budget, update your revised budgets and so on
- You can then chart your query results and determine how the results should be displayed using the Graph options
- You can then export the results of your analysis (data and chart) to a variety of export formats including Excel, PDF and HTML

New Sales and Purchase Invoices Due Reports
To help with credit control and cash collection processes we've added 2 new reports:
- Sales Invoices Due: A listing of sales invoices ordered by due date, allowing for customer credit days. Customer contact details are also provided
- Purchase Invoices Due: A listing of purchase invoices due for payment ordered by due date. This also allows for supplier credit terms agreed
